DISASTER REPORT: Andrew (KC8SPD) and Russ presented the group with a description of our response to assist local first responders in a barricaded gunman event that happened in Port Huron. Along with a description of our efforts was a reference to things we learned from that event. The Red Cross provided food and beverages to the responding Emergency Agencies. We concluded that every responding Red Cross vehicle should have at least one ARCARS member to provide radio connectivity and provide a coordinated effort. The Chapter House and Director received complements on our efforts to assist the Sheriff and Police Departments.

On October 3rd, there was a structure fire at a senior citizen assisted living home. While four people escaped, there were three fatalities. Russ (KD8FRE) responded to the site and began relief support operations for the responding agencies. We were able to expedite the arrival of food and beverages to the scene for the responders. The Agencies expressed that they like to have the Red Cross respond at the scene as soon as possible. It was recommended that the person living closest to a disaster to go to the area and request additional help while on the scene. Our truck should be immediately deployed.

The ARCARS & International Traders Net is held every Tuesday evening at 8pm on the 146.800 K8ARC repeater.

The International Friendship Net is held every Thursday at 9pm on the 145.370-VA3SAR repeater

The Thumb / Mid Michigan Nets are held Monday through Saturday at 9:30pm on the 147.300 repeater.

HF: The Great Lakes Emergency and Traffic Net is held nightly at 6pm on 3.932 kHz (temporary time change from the customary 8pm slot)
